Duties

Performs the following faculty duties in the Scientific Test and Analysis Techniques Center of Excellence (STAT COE)Air Force Institute of Technology:
Leading the STAT COE and the HS CoBP

Supports the Director in leading the Air Force Institute of Technology's Scientific Test and Analysis Techniques (STAT) Center of Excellence, ensuring this Office of the Secretary of Defense (OSD) designated Center is properly resourced to accomplish its mission. Supports leadership of the Homeland Security Community of Best Practices to enhance test and evaluation (T&E) in the Department of Homeland Security (DHS). Represents the STAT COE and acts as Director as required when the Director is not available. Contributes to the development and implementation of strategic vision and mission of the STAT COE: "To develop and apply independent, tailored STAT solutions to T&E that deliver insight to inform better decisions." Works directly with senior leaders from across OSD, the Armed Services, and DHS to enhance the scientific rigor of T&E across the enterprise. Interacts with the Executive Director, DTE&A (Developmental Test, Evaluation, and Assessment) to provide advice and STAT support to help execute the DTE&A vision for DOD-wide T&E. Supports the Director through contract execution and oversight as the Assistant Contracting Officer Representative (ACOR), including coordinating with DTIC and the contracting offices to transfer funding and execute contract modifications. Responsible for contract execution oversight, including tracking expenditures and schedule to ensure the production of quality deliverables within the period of performance. Participates in negotiations with new customers to formalize proposals that specify scope, cost, and deliverables, and manages the proposals process from initial draft to closeout. Oversees Center personnel in developing and producing best practices and case studies that help practitioners readily understand and seek to apply STAT in their programs. Participates in outreach across the DOD and DHS T&E communities to raise awareness of T&E issues and advancements, and to locate, identify, and pursue potential collaboration opportunities and sponsorships.


Overseeing Center's Consulting Capability and Efforts
Manages and oversees the STAT COE subject matter experts ("STAT Experts") as they engage with teams and organizations to provide STAT advice, mentorship, and assistance in T&E activities such as test planning, test design, experimentation, data analysis, and M&S. Ensures STAT Experts are capable of productively engaging and interacting with customers to enable effective integration. Advises the Director in the assignment of STAT Experts to consulting activities to optimally match skills and capabilities to customer challenges. Receives periodic update on the status, challenges, and path forward for all ongoing STAT consulting engagements to identify trends and vector STAT Experts appropriately for success.


Managing Center's Applied Research Efforts
Assembles and oversees teams of STAT Experts as they conduct STAT-related applied research that is relevant and valuable to customer organizations. Works with potential customers to understand their STAT gaps and desired outcomes that can be effectively addressed through applied research activities and deliverables. Coordinates the authoring and formalizing of proposals that accurately document applied research projects, including scope & tasks, cost, period of performance (POP), and deliverables. Tracks cost, schedule, and performance of each applied research project through periodic reviews. Reviews deliverables to ensure quality prior to review by the Director and delivery to the customer.

Provides STAT Expert Workforce Development Opportunities
Leads the development and execution of STAT classes that are funded by sponsors to be tailored and directly relevant to their needs. Writes and coordinates the formalizing of proposals that ensure each customer receives the precise academic instruction needed by its audience, in a cost-effective manner. Maintains a library of classes with corresponding materials that can be executed at the behest of new sponsors. Ensures the quality of the class materials and instruction. Ensures STAT COE workforce development efforts are synergistic with those of other organizations such as AFIT/EN, AFIT/LS, and DAU.

The Air Force Institute of Technology (AFIT) is regionally accredited by The Higher Learning Commission (HLC). In addition to its regional accreditation, the Engineering Accreditation Commission of ABET accredits the following master's degree programs in the Graduate School of Engineering and Management: Aeronautical Engineering, Astronautical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Nuclear Engineering, Environmental Engineering and Science, Engineering Management, and Systems Engineering. Also, the Industrial Hygiene master's degree program is accredited by the Applied Science Accreditation Commission of ABET.

AFIT's Carnegie Classification is: Doctoral Universities - High Research Activity
